You can either live boot from the iso or install it to your Virtual box. We need to create a partition of the free space for Android x86 to be installed. Select the partition and select the New option in the lower panel to create a new partition. And select the amount to be allocated. If you just want a simple installation, create one partition taking up the entire disk and format it as ext4.

Continue through the installation. You should install GRUB when it prompts you to. Finaly, start Android-x If it's a new machine, once loaded you can perform the Android setup to begin using your machine.

Specify the Android-x86 ISO that you downloaded. Click the green Start arrow to power-on your virtual machine. You'll be presented with a list of options. Use the arrow keys to pick which one you want, then press Enter once the one you want is selected. If you don't want to install Android-x86 yet and just want to test it, pick one of the Live CD options except for Debug mode.

Pick the Installation option if you want your system to be installed to the virtual hard drive.
